Flight Test Quality Manager
Company:
The Boeing Company
The Boeing Company is seeking a Flight Test Quality Manager to join our team in Seattle, WA The selected candidate will be responsible for the management of non-exempt (IAM751) hourly Flight Test Quality inspectors supporting both commercial and military derivative programs.
This position is based in Seattle but may also require working at other Puget Sound sites.
This position is for second shift, Monday through Friday and possible overtime.
Domestic and international travel may be required based on business needs.
Position Responsibilities:
Manage employees who evaluate and ensure that products, services and processes comply with customer contract requirements, engineering requirements, company procedures and government regulations
Develop and execute business plans, policies and procedures and develops organizational and technical strategies to improve performance
Provide education and coaching on the Quality System
May make airworthiness determinations on behalf of the company and regulatory agencies
Acquire and manage resources and leads process improvements
Develop and maintain relationships and partnerships with customers, stakeholders, peers, partners, suppliers and direct reports
Manage, develop and motivate employees

Basic Qualifications (Required Skills/Experience):
Ability to obtain a U.S. Security Clearance for which the U.S. Government requires U.S. Citizenship
Candidates must have at least one year of experience in a leadership role (team leader, temp manager, large scale cross functional project/program management, or formal manager experience) OR have completed the Boeing internal course “Exploring Leadership.”
Have an FAA Airframe and Power Plant License or an FAA Repairman’s certificate
5+ years of experience with flight line operations
5+ years of experience with Boeing single body and wide body aircraft models
Ability and willingness to travel domestically and internationally on short notice
Preferred Qualifications (Desired Skills/Experience):
5+ years of experience in a field quality inspector position
Material Review Board Designee
Active U.S. Secret Security Clearance (U.S. Citizenship Required). (A U.S. Security Clearance that has been active in the past 24 months is considered active)
5+ years of experience with Boeing maintenance execution systems (CMES, MESci, Velocity)
3+ years of experience working in a Flight Test environment
2+ years of experience as a manager or Quality Inspector supporting field operations
Strong familiarity with FAA CFAR Title 14 parts 91 and 145
Strong familiarity with FAA Coordinator duties (conformities and aircraft ticketing)
